Language Support

While Subscribr's interface is in English, you can chat and create scripts in virtually any language. Here's how language settings work throughout the app.

Overview

  • App Interface - English only
  • Chat conversations - Any language
  • Script creation - Any language
  • Research sources - Any language

Chatting in Other Languages

You can have conversations with the AI in any language. Simply type your messages in your preferred language, and the AI will respond in kind.

Setting a Default Chat Language

If you want the AI to always respond in a specific language:

  1. Go to Chat Settings
  2. In the Custom Instructions field, add: Always respond in [language]
  3. Save your settings

This instruction will be included with every chat message you send.

Mixing Languages

You can chat in one language while creating scripts in another. For example, you might discuss your video concept in Portuguese but generate the final script in English.

Creating Scripts in Other Languages

You can select which language to write your script in:

  • In Canvas: When the canvas first opens, you'll see planning questions along with a Language dropdown where you can select your target language
  • In Script Builder (Legacy): The language setting appears on the first page when creating a script

Channel Default Language

You can set a default language for your channel in Channel Settings (accessible from your channels page). All new scripts will start with that language selected, which is useful if you consistently create content in a language other than English.

Research in Any Language

Your research sources can be in any language:

  • YouTube video transcripts in any language
  • Web articles in any language
  • Uploaded documents in any language

Subscribr will process and understand content regardless of language. You can mix research sources in different languages - for example, using English research papers alongside Japanese video transcripts.

Common Use Cases

Creating Content for International Audiences

If you create content in multiple languages:

  1. Set up separate channels for each language
  2. Configure each channel's default language
  3. Train voice profiles from content in that language
  4. Your scripts will naturally match the target audience

Translating Concepts

You can research content in one language and create scripts in another:

  1. Analyze successful videos in English (or any language)
  2. Use that research as context
  3. Generate your script in your target language

The AI will adapt the concepts while maintaining cultural relevance for your audience.

Researching Global Trends

Use Intel to explore what's working in other markets:

  1. Filter by language in Intel search
  2. Study successful formats in different regions
  3. Adapt those concepts for your audience

Limitations

  • The app interface remains in English
  • Some AI features work best with widely-spoken languages
  • Highly specialized or rare languages may have reduced accuracy

Tips for Non-English Scripts

  • Provide research sources in your target language when possible
  • Train your voice profile using samples in your target language
  • Review generated content carefully for cultural nuances
  • Use Chat Settings to set your preferred response language
